FROM PULLMAN — Our weekly picks column in the newspaper ended last weekend with the final full slate of Pac-12 games. But since two more games involving conference teams remain until the bowl season, we’ll go ahead and forecast those real quick for the record.

UCLA at Stanford (Pac-12 championship game, 5 p.m. Friday on FOX), Stanford by 8.5 — I’d expect more of a fight from UCLA this time around, but the result should be the same as it was last week. Cardinal to the Rose Bowl. Stanford 28-21.

Nicholls State at Oregon State (11:30 a.m. Saturday, Pac-12 Networks), no line — Maybe the Beavers couldn’t keep up with the Ducks last week because they were looking ahead to this showdown. OSU 49-10.

Season record : 68-21 straight up, 43-37 against the spread
